Description
Frontal pole anatomy anchors this inferior view of the cerebral hemispheres, highlighting the rounded anterior extremity of each frontal lobe on the orbital surface. Medially, the gyrus rectus runs anteroposterior along the interhemispheric fissure, while laterally the orbital gyri are separated by the H-shaped orbital sulcus. The olfactory sulcus lies just lateral to the gyrus rectus and typically accommodates the olfactory bulb and tract on the ventral frontal lobe, placing the frontal pole in immediate relationship to the anterior cranial fossa above the orbits. Orbitofrontal topography matters when correlating focal deficits with lesions at the anterior cranial base, where trauma, meningioma, and esthesioneuroblastoma can involve the olfactory apparatus and adjacent inferior frontal cortex. An inferior perspective helps you orient the medial-lateral arrangement of gyrus rectus, olfactory sulcus, and orbital gyri, a relationship that is often harder to appreciate in lateral teaching views. Small positional differences are clinically meaningful. Neurosurgical teams can pair this illustration with descriptions of a subfrontal or bifrontal approach, where retraction planes and the risk to olfactory bulbs are planned relative to the ventral frontal surface and midline landmarks. It also fits neuroanatomy and neuropsychology curricula covering orbitofrontal cortex injury patterns, including impaired judgment and disinhibition after anterior cranial fossa fractures, as well as radiology primers that map inferior frontal gyri and sulci to coronal MRI slices at the level of the orbits.
